Program Manager, Risk Operations & Resilience
CBRE is seeking a Program Manager to lead process optimization and scaling initiatives for a client’s global facility audit program, which evaluates hundreds of facilities annually and aims to proactively reduce facility risk. The primary focus is to support program execution globally. A US-based role is preferred. This role directly supports risk mitigation across a portfolio of hundreds of global facilities, making processes more efficient and scalable.
What You’ll Do:- Design and implement scalable facility audit processes and workflows
- Partner with facility leaders and internal subject matter experts to resolve risk findings efficiently
- Manage large datasets and dashboards, and develop automation strategies with technical teams
- Drive program schedule, metrics, reporting, and continuous improvement initiatives
- Anticipate program risks and develop mitigation plans
- Coordinate vendor management and deliverable quality standards
- Lead cross‑functional collaboration across global regions
- Facilitate weekly alignment meetings on program‑specific updates
- Support additional global facility risk management initiatives as needed
- Bachelor’s degree in engineering, architecture, risk management, business, or related field
- 5-7 years program management experience, strong data management experience, and experience with global teams
- Ability to work independently in a fast‑paced and rapidly changing environment
- Superior written and verbal communication skills, including proven ability to effectively manage, influence, negotiate, and communicate with external business partners and internal teams
- Proficient in project management software (e.g., Asana, Smartsheet, etc.) and Microsoft Office
- MBA, master’s degree, or other advanced degree in Architecture, Engineering, Risk Management, or related field
- Fulfillment/distribution network design, planning, or execution experience
- Familiarity with compliance, facility audit programs, or property insurance or builder’s risk management processes
- Familiarity with basic real estate or design and construction workflows
- Proficient in dashboarding and visualization tools (Quick Suite, Tableau)
